FORMAL — Definition of FORMAL

6 letters
/ˈfɔːməl/
noun
1
Formalin.
2
An evening gown.
3
An event with a formal dress code.
Jenny took Sam to her Year 12 formal.
4
A formal parameter.
adjective
1
Being in accord with established forms.
She spoke formal English, without any dialect.
2
Official.
I'd like to make a formal complaint.
3
Relating to the form or structure of something.
Formal linguistics ignores the vocabulary of languages and focuses solely on their grammar.
4
Relating to formation.
The formal stage is a critical part of any child's development.
